import re
import requests
import xlwt
import time
import xlrd
start = time.time()
a = 1
b = 0
list1 = []
list2 = []
EveData_book = xlrd.open_workbook(r'F:\下载文件\evedata.xls')
EveData_sheet = EveData_book.sheet_by_index(0)
row = int(EveData_sheet.nrows)
for n in range(0, 8200):
value_a = str(int(EveData_sheet.cell_value(a, b)))
print(value_a)
list1.append(value_a)
value_b = EveData_sheet.cell_value(a, b + 1)
list2.append(value_b)
a = a + 1
dict = dict(zip(list2, list1))
step1 = time.time()
excel_eve = xlwt.Workbook(encoding="utf-8")
sheet_eve = excel_eve.add_sheet("单价")
a = 3
b = 2
for key in dict.keys():
url = "
https://www.ceve-market.org/api/market/region/10000002/type/" + dict[key] + ".xml"
i = requests.get(url)
i = i.text
price_list = re.findall('<min>(.*?)</min>', i)
price = price_list[2]
sheet_eve.write(a, b, key)
sheet_eve.write(a, b+1, price)
a = a + 1
excel_eve.save('F:\eve市场.xls')
end = time.time()
print(step1 - start)
print(end - start)